jeongee 发表于 2011-4-22 09:41:44

初识DiliCMS系列之二:附件上传

本帖最后由 jeongee 于 2011-4-22 09:43 编辑

DiliCMS的附件上传使用的是discuz 7.2的flash上传控件,使用ci自带session类库,规避了非ie核心的flash的cookie bug导致上传无法验证的问题,具体大家可以去看看代码,在这里我也发几张截图:)
1.控件默认状态
   
2.展开控件面板



3.选择文件准备上传



4.文件上传完成



5.js显示


5.删除附件



我只是测试了IE9,FIREFOX 4 ,CHROME,其他版本浏览器尚未测试,有待同学们反馈,感激不尽~~~

zfm1988 发表于 2011-4-22 12:08:48

上传的功能很实用啊,请问下我能不能把这个功能集成到我自己的项目中呢??算不算是侵权呢?

jeongee 发表于 2011-4-22 12:12:55

回复 2# zfm1988


   呵呵,我是反编译discuz 的上传swf,嘿嘿,-_-,我的UI不行,不然我就自己写了

zfm1988 发表于 2011-4-22 12:16:51

呵呵,不错!我曾经也反编译了几个swf??

但是楼主为什么不用jquery.uploadify http://www.uploadify.com/这个貌似很不错呢?也有上面的功能呢?且开源呢

jeongee 发表于 2011-4-22 12:26:13

回复 4# zfm1988


   用过的,我喜欢flash内置上传界面

古树 发表于 2011-4-22 22:54:08

个人感觉还是用html自带的上传控件比较好,html5已经大势所趋

008shanke 发表于 2011-4-27 09:12:05

都是好东西,看谁用

chjp_php 发表于 2011-4-27 09:17:23

好东西,好好学一下。

citywill 发表于 2011-8-4 17:00:45

没看见附件字段类型啊

mvc999 发表于 2011-8-4 17:46:36

这个插件在google浏览器下无法正常使用,不知道什么原因,绝对flash绝对不是好东西,就相当于,用瓶子装水,又在外面套了一个麻袋!:lol,能修改最好!
页: [1] 2 3
查看完整版本: 初识DiliCMS系列之二:附件上传